Verizon Wireless Number Portability is a significant feature in the telecom world, allowing you to keep your phone number when switching carriers. This flexibility not only empowers consumers but also enhances competition among service providers, ensuring better services and pricing. Understanding how this process works can save you time and hassle, making your transition smooth and efficient.
From the initial application to the final transfer, the number portability process is designed to be user-friendly. It involves a series of steps that ensure your number is safely transitioned without interruption to your service. Moreover, being aware of the requirements and potential hiccups can help you navigate this journey with confidence.

Expert Answers
What is number portability?
Number portability allows you to keep your phone number when switching from one carrier to another.
How long does the number porting process take?
Typically, the porting process can take anywhere from a few hours to a couple of days, depending on various factors.
Will I lose service during the porting process?
No, you should not experience a loss of service. The transfer is designed to be seamless.
Do I need to cancel my old service before porting?

No, you should not cancel your old service before initiating the porting process, as it may complicate the transfer.
Can I port a landline number to Verizon?
Yes, you can port a landline number to Verizon, provided the number is eligible for transfer.
